I just want to know that if there are no symptoms in eye vision but still the eye test reports are showing a sign of cataract...is it possible?
Is the surgery is the only way for its treatment.
My father has this concern, he was under medication for the same for almost 6months but now after the regular eye checkups doctors are suggesting for surgery but my father is telling he is not facing any eye vision issues.
Suggest please.

If vision is not improving with glasses,and he needs better vision for his day to day activities,he can undergo surgery. The vision after surgery will be for better than before. Pl consult ophthalmologist for further evaluation and treatment.
If he can see with spectacles till then no intervention needed, but even with refractive correction his vision is not improving or there is diminution of vision then surgery required.
Yes surgery is the only option to get rid of this.
